What they do

A Nursing Assistant provides hospital and nursing home patients with basic care and assists them with daily activities. Helps patients with dressing, washing, and feeding. May perform basic medical care under the direction of a nurse or other medical professional. These roles typically require completion of a regional agency-approved training program in order to obtain a certification before practicing.

Job Summary:
The CNA's main objective is to provide quality care to the community residents as specified on individualized resident care plan/Med Plan according to established policies, procedures and objectives of our community. Under the supervision of Resident Care Director, the CNA is responsible to provide residents with medication management, assistance for activities of daily living, physical comfort, emotional and social support. Communication with doctors offices on a routine basis.
Additional Responsibilities:
Employee must have a great personality and enjoy working with seniors. Employee must be patient, caring and have the ability to do task at a slower pace in order to accommodate all residents' needs.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ities Required :
a) Age 18 or older. b) High School Diploma, GED or equivalency required. c) Maintain current CNA, First Aid, CPR and Food Handlers Certifications. d) At least 1 year prior experience with the geriatric and/or dementia population preferred. e) Computer proficiency and a working knowledge of Microsoft programs required. f) Ability to read, write, speak and comprehend the English Language.
